Art Appreciation

The artwork transports you to a serene mountain village, nestled amidst rolling green hills under a vast, moody sky. Buildings with weathered wooden facades and aged stone foundations dot the landscape, suggesting a deep history and connection to the earth. A winding path, lined with a rustic fence, leads towards the village, hinting at the journey and the lives lived within these humble dwellings.

The artist's technique, evident in the soft brushstrokes and the way light plays on the mountains, creates a sense of depth and atmosphere. The color palette, dominated by earthy greens, browns, and the deep blues of the distant peaks, evokes a feeling of tranquility and the raw beauty of nature. The composition is balanced, drawing the eye from the foreground path to the village and finally to the imposing mountains that frame the scene. It's a visual poem, a moment captured in time, that celebrates the simplicity and enduring strength of rural life.
